Farmers & Merchants Investments Inc. Makes New $5.97 Million Investment in Fiserv, Inc. $FISV

Farmers & Merchants Investments Inc. bought a new position in shares of Fiserv, Inc. (NASDAQ:FISVFree Report) during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the SEC. The fund bought 88,890 shares of the business services provider’s stock, valued at approximately $5,971,000.

Several other institutional investors and hedge funds also recently added to or reduced their stakes in FISV. Vanguard Group Inc. acquired a new position in Fiserv during the 4th quarter worth approximately $3,507,063,000. Capital World Investors increased its position in Fiserv by 35.2% during the 3rd quarter. Capital World Investors now owns 25,781,919 shares of the business services provider’s stock worth $3,324,073,000 after purchasing an additional 6,714,536 shares during the period. Pittenger & Anderson Inc. acquired a new position in Fiserv during the 4th quarter worth approximately $193,349,000. Loring Wolcott & Coolidge Fiduciary Advisors LLP MA acquired a new position in Fiserv during the 4th quarter worth approximately $174,502,000. Finally, Barclays PLC increased its position in Fiserv by 116.0% during the 3rd quarter. Barclays PLC now owns 3,528,906 shares of the business services provider’s stock worth $454,982,000 after purchasing an additional 1,895,349 shares during the period. Institutional investors and hedge funds own 90.98% of the company’s stock.

Fiserv Price Performance

FISV stock opened at $55.48 on Friday. Fiserv, Inc. has a 1 year low of $52.91 and a 1 year high of $191.91.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.06, a quick ratio of 1.03 and a current ratio of 1.06. The stock’s 50 day moving average price is $59.09 and its 200 day moving average price is $65.65. The firm has a market cap of $29.58 billion, a P/E ratio of 9.40, a PEG ratio of 1.76 and a beta of 0.84.

Fiserv (NASDAQ:FISVG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Tuesday, May 5th. The business services provider reported $1.79 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.57 by $0.22. Fiserv had a return on equity of 17.46% and a net margin of 15.17%.The firm had revenue of $4.68 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$4.73 billion. The business’s revenue was down 2.0% on a year-over-year basis. Fiserv has set its FY 2026 guidance at 8.000-8.300 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ts expect that Fiserv, Inc. will post 8.13 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Wall Street Analyst Weigh In

FISV has been the topic of several recent analyst reports. Weiss Ratings upgraded Fiserv from a “sell (d)” rating to a “sell (d+)” rating in a research report on Friday, May 1st. BMO Capital Markets assumed coverage on Fiserv in a research report on Tuesday, April 21st. They set a “market perform” rating and a $65.00 target price on the stock. Northcoast Research cut Fiserv from a “buy” rating to a “neutral” rating in a report on Monday, February 2nd. Truist Financial lowered their price target on Fiserv from $65.00 to $64.00 and set a “hold” rating on the stock in a report on Friday, April 24th. Finally, Cantor Fitzgerald restated a “neutral” rating and issued a $70.00 price target on shares of Fiserv in a report on Wednesday, March 11th. Eight equities research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, twenty-seven have issued a Hold rating and one has given a Sell rating to the stock. According to data from MarketBeat, Fiserv currently has an average rating of “Hold” and a consensus target price of $87.48.

About Fiserv

(Free Report)

Fiserv, Inc, founded in 1984 and headquartered in Brookfield, Wisconsin, is a global provider of financial services technology. The company develops and delivers integrated solutions for payments, processing, risk and compliance, customer and channel management, and business insights and optimization. Serving thousands of clients, Fiserv supports banks, credit unions, securities broker-dealers, leasing and finance companies, and retailers.

Fiserv’s core offerings include account processing systems that automate deposit, lending and transaction processing for financial institutions, as well as digital banking platforms that enable mobile and online banking services.
